Linux 如何查看 文件被那个用户修改了
时间: 2024-01-23 16:04:14 浏览: 28
你可以使用 `ls -l` 命令来查看文件的详细信息,包括文件的所有者和最后的修改时间。例如:
```
$ ls -l file.txt
-rw-r--r-- 1 user1 user1 1024 Jul 15 09:30 file.txt
```
其中,`user1` 表示文件的所有者。如果你想查看最后修改文件的用户,可以使用 `stat` 命令,例如:
```
$ stat file.txt
File: 'file.txt'
Size: 1024 Blocks: 8 IO Block: 4096 regular file
Device: fd00h/64768d Inode: 123456 Links: 1
Access: (0644/-rw-r--r--) Uid: ( 501/ user1) Gid: ( 20/ group1)
Access: 2021-07-15 09:30:00.000000000 +0800
Modify: 2021-07-15 10:30:00.000000000 +0800
Change: 2021-07-15 10:30:00.000000000 +0800
Birth: -
```
其中,`Uid` 表示最后修改文件的用户,`Gid` 表示最后修改文件的用户所在的组。
相关问题
Linux修改文件用户
在Linux中,可以使用chown命令来修改文件的用户。chown命令的语法为:
```
chown [选项] 用户名 文件名
```
其中,用户名为需要修改成的用户的用户名,文件名为需要修改用户的文件名。如果需要同时修改文件的用户和用户组,可以使用chown命令的-R选项来递归地修改目录及其子目录下的所有文件。
例如,如果需要将文件test.txt的用户修改为root,则可以使用以下命令:
```
sudo chown root test.txt
```
如果需要递归地将目录/home/user1下所有文件的用户修改为root,则可以使用以下命令:
```
sudo chown -R root /home/user1
```
Linux通过更改配置文件修改用户密码
在Linux中,通过更改/etc/passwd文件或使用passwd命令修改用户密码。
1. 修改/etc/passwd文件
使用文本编辑器(如vi或nano)打开/etc/passwd文件,找到要更改密码的用户名所在行。该行的格式如下:
username:password:UID:GID:comment:home directory:login shell
将密码字段(通常是一长串加密后的字符)删除,然后输入新密码。保存文件并关闭文本编辑器。
请注意,在这种方法中,密码是以明文形式出现在文件中,因此应该非常小心以防泄露。
2. 使用passwd命令
使用以下命令更改用户的密码:
```
passwd username
```
该命令将提示您输入新密码。新密码将被加密并存储在/etc/shadow文件中,以确保安全性。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)